Notes:
| |
---|---|
1.
|
A City 15% Administration fee is included in the above stated
review fees, with the exception of items noted with #6 or #7 below.
|
2.
|
All fees apply to the initial submittal and one resubmittal
in response to initial review comments. Subsequent submittals beyond
the first two will be charged addition fees for the actual time and
expenses of the City Engineer at the charge out rates and fee schedule
effective upon the date of subsequent reviews.
|
3.
|
Construction Inspections-will be charged in addition to fees
for the actual time and expense of the City Engineer at the charge
out rates and fee schedule effective upon the date of subsequent reviews.
|
4.
|
Fee includes publication costs.
|
5.
|
In addition to the fees herein, in order to maintain necessary
funding of the City and its services, applicants for zoning/rezoning,
special use, and variances shall be charged for the actual publication
and processing expenses exceeding $250 incurred by the City in publishing
legal notices and direct mail notifications for such application.
|
6.
|
Engineer review is not generally necessary for this type of
application, therefore the fee stated herein does not include any
engineer review fees and the City retains 100% of the fee. If any
engineer review is necessary the applicant will also be responsible
for the cost of the engineer review.
|
7.
|
Engineer review fee is $200 for review of Concept Plan. City's
portion is $600 of which City retains 100%.
|
